Mailyn Fernandez Montoya is a highly decorated healthcare executive with nearly 25 years of experience in home health, medical management, and the behavioral health industry. She has an undying passion for ensuring that patients receive care at home with the utmost compassion and clinical expertise.
Prior to her years of service in the home health and behavioral health arena, Mailyn held a variety of leadership and administrative roles with physician practices and integrated healthcare delivery networks. Her professional journey reflects both depth and breadth, with accomplishments that have earned her the Award of Excellence in Nursing, the Award of Distinction for Health Care Law, the Award of Excellence in Health Care Administration, and the Award of Distinction in Consumer Health, all recognized by her industry peers.
Mailyn holds an Associate’s Degree in Health Care Administration, a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N), and a Master Diploma in Marriage and Family Counseling. Her passion for behavioral health was born out of personal experience, inspiring her to ensure quality, compassionate care for the pediatric population. Through her vision, dedication, and leadership, A1A Behavioral Health has become one of the fastest-growing behavioral health companies in the State of Florida.
As one of the main leaders of America Loving Care (ALC) and A1A, Mailyn has helped shape programs that provide high-quality, compassionate services to families across the community. She serves on the Parent to Parent of Miami Board of Trustees, where she advocates for meaningful change and expanded support for families navigating disability and special needs. She is also a founding organizational volunteer of the Live Like Bella® Childhood Cancer Foundation. Mailyn passionately gives of her time with the goal of eradicating childhood cancer and advocating for children affected by the disease.
